The Critical Role Of Advanced Metrics

Gone are the days of relying solely on season averages for ESPN NFL week 5 predictions. Modern analysis dives into advanced metrics like success rate, pressure rates, and defensive efficiency against specific formations. These data points reveal underlying trends that box scores often obscure, such as a team's ability to convert third downs in tight windows or a pass rush's effectiveness against zone coverage.
